Ken asked us what Strategic and Innovation meant to us. At this point my understanding of these two words are:- Strategic to me sounds very military. Specific plans are made to reach a specific goal and specific steps have to be taken to reach that goal.

Innovation to me means creativity, openess, stepping out of the norm, looking for differences, trying new things.

My understanding so far on Strategic leadership and Innovation is that the leadership has strategies to reach it's goals, the innovation is part of the leadership model which creates an atmosphere of building teamwork, sharing of ideas, trust, creating a healthier work culture in order to reach the goals in a more conducive and cooperative manner. To me it sounds more like my understanding of stewardship leadership.
